V503 Cyg superhump observation at Gunma We have received the following report from Kunjaya-san, who is observing at Gunma Astronomocal Observatory. The Kyoto team (Ishioka, Iwamatsu, Uemura, Matsumoto, Kato) has also obtained a few nights' data, which is subject to further analysis. --- Dear all, The observation of V503 Cyg on Nov 29, 2000 at Gunma Astronomocal Observatory shows a clear light variation with amplitude about 0.2 mag and period 116 minutes. Instrument : 65 cm reflector and Apogee CCD camera. Time coverage : 3 hours 20 minutes Sky condition clear in the begining and the end. Cloud pass arround the middle of observation. The period estimates is tentative and will be verified. Regards, Kunjaya
